CLKCON (0xC6) – Clock Control
Bit Name
Reset R/W Description
7
OSC32K
1
R/W 32 kHz clock oscillator select. The HS RCOSC must be selected as system clock
source when this bit is to be changed.
0
32.768 kHz crystal oscillator
1
Low power RC oscillator (32 – 36 kHz for CC2510Fx and 32 kHz for
CC2511Fx)
Note: This bit is not retained in PM2 and PM3. After re-entry to active mode from
one of these power modes this bit will be at the reset value 1.
6
OSC
1
R/W System clock oscillator select.
0
High speed crystal oscillator
1
HS RC oscillator
This setting will only take effect when the selected oscillator is powered up and
stable. If the high speed crystal oscillator is not powered up, it should be enabled
by setting SLEEP.OSC_PD to 0 prior to selecting it as source. If the HS RCOSC
is to be the source and it is powered down, setting this bit will turn it on.
